Kerala actress assault case: Pulsar Suni and 5 others sentenced to 20 years jail, Rs 50,000 fine

A Kerala court has sentenced Pulsar Suni and five others to 20 years in prison for the 2017 actress assault case, while ordering Rs 5 lakh compensation for the victim. Actor Dileep, accused of conspiracy, was acquitted after a six-year trial

Days after the court acquitted actor Dileep in the 2017 actress assault case, the bench has delivered its verdict on the punishment for the six convicted in the case. Pulsar Suni who is the prime accused in the case has been sentenced to 20 years in prison. 

Punishment announced in actress assault case

Ernakulam District and Principal Sessions Court Judge Honey M Varghese sentenced Sunil NS, also known as Pulsar Suni, Martin Antony, Manikandan B, Vijesh VP, Salim H, and Pradeep to 20 years of rigorous imprisonment for the offence of gang rape. The court also ordered imprisonment for other offences, but they will run concurrently.
